Crude oil futures close at record high of $91.86 |
 |
+ |
- |
13:50, October 27, 2007 |
Crude-oil futures closed at a new record on Friday, as worries over energy supplies and tensions in the Middle East propelled the market to a new peak.
Crude oil for December delivery climbed 1.40 U.S. dollars to end at 91.86 U.S. dollars a barrel on the New York Mercantile Exchange.
Earlier Friday, the contract rose to a new record intraday high of 92.22 dollars a barrel in electronic trading.
Crude recorded a gain of 4.91 dollars in the week from last Friday's closing level of 86.95 dollars. Source: Xinhua
